In an electrolysis experiment current was passed for 5 hours through two cells connected in series. The first cell contains a solution of gold at the oxidation state of + 3 and second contain CuSO 4 solution. During electrolysis in the first cell 9.85 gm of gold is deposited, determine the average gm of copper deposited per ampere of electricity passed in the nearest possible integers.
Cu – 63.5 ; Au – 197

Sol. Amount of Au deposited = 
= 0.05 mol
∴ Amount of electrons passed
= 0.05 × 3 = 0.15 mol
∴ Quantity of electricity passed
= 0.15F = 96500 × 0.15 C
∴ Quantity of current passed
=
= 0.8042 amp
Mass of Cu deposited
=
= 4.7625 gm
∴ 
=
= 5.92 ~ 6
